About The Position

The San Mateo County Registration & Elections Division is seeking full-time seasonal extra-help Election Materials Proofreaders to assist in the upcoming November 3, 2026 Statewide General Election. This is an excellent nonpartisan opportunity to be involved in the election process. Proofreaders will be hired into one of four language-based teams (English, Chinese, Filipino, or Spanish). This announcement is for Chinese (Mandarin) proofreaders. All Proofreaders will be responsible for proofreading and copyediting election materials leading up to established election deadlines. Proofreaders will review, edit, and proofread documents in traditional Mandarin Chinese for accuracy, context, readability, and syntax. Proofreaders will work remotely using equipment provided by the Registration & Elections Division. Towards the end of the assignment, two days of on-site work will be required for final proofs of physical material. Important: Per County policy, employees of the County of San Mateo must reside in California. Examples of projects and materials needing to be proofread include, but are not limited to: Sample Ballot & Voter Information Pamphlet, Official Ballot, Remote Accessible Vote by Mail system, Website content, Legal documents, Letters, flyers, postcards, and other notices to voters. The Elections Materials Proofreader is classified as an Office Specialist. The hourly wage for this position starts at $33.44. NOTE: This is an extra-help, at-will assignment, paid on an hourly basis. Extra-help hours are dependent on the business needs of the department and therefore work hours may vary from week to week. Extra help employees shall not exceed 1,040 hours of work per fiscal year. Some extra-help positions are eligible for benefits under the Affordable Care Act. Extra-help employees are not guaranteed permanent status at the end of the assignment.
